ROISIN O'DONNELL \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eA yearning for their missing mothers pulls Vernice and Annie apart. It will take a devastating tragedy to bring them back together. Vernice and Annie are 'cradle friends', born days apart in Honeysuckle, Louisiana, both destined never to know their mothers.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cspan\u003eThe girls are inseparable, bound by a friendship far deeper than sisterhood. But this is the American south in the 1950s. Black girls like Vernice and Annie have to fight for every opportunity they can, and neither one can build the future they hope for in Honeysuckle. Gradually, inevitably, the girls drift apart.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cspan\u003eVernice pursues her education; Annie is lured by the promise of a heady first love affair and a growing obsession with finding her mother. But her search pulls her even further into a world of danger that soon leaves her oldest friend battling to save her. Tayari Jones returns with an exuberant, richly told story about mothers, daughters, and a lifelong friendship that is as dangerous as it is unbreakable.  \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e \u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Collected","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":56737120878972,"sku":null,"price":18.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0578\/5662\/2637\/files\/9780861543908.jpg?v=1778064853","url":"https:\/\/collectedbooks.co.uk\/products\/caly-reccomends-kin-tayari-jones","provider":"Collected","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
